If Battel filed your case in Washington County, here's what the data shows: 44.8% of their 113 cases were dismissed, and 51.7% resulted in conviction. That's near the Washington County average of 40.4%. Statewide, this is higher than 69% of Virginia officers.

The most common charge in this officer's cases is Traffic Infraction (83 cases, 48.4% dismissed), followed by Other (15 cases). What happens in your case depends on your specific charge, the facts, and the court — but this data gives you a starting point.

Based on 113 public court records, 2025. Cases heard at Washington County District Court. Dismissal rate includes cases dropped by the court or prosecutor. Conviction rate includes guilty pleas and trial verdicts. Last updated: May 2, 2026
